The conductivity of semiconductors lies in diapason between conductivity of metals and conductivity of isolators. This characteristic is caused the division of semiconductors as a divided class. There are some elements that are basically utilized to develop the semiconductor devices. They are germanium, selenium, silicon, etc.

There is a possibility to transform almost every kind of energy into electric power by mans of semiconductors. Heat and cold may be produced by some kinds of semiconductors. Semiconductors perform the basic functions in many various devices: atomic batteries, quantum generators, processors and even primitive radio receivers. Such devices as voltage sensors are commonly utilized in any construction connected to the electricity. In case we compare devices operating on semiconductors and tube devices we can realize that semiconductors are significantly smaller and lighter. The analogue devices are not equal in case we speak about their reliability and power. Tube falls behind.
